President Trump’s catastrophic decision to plunge the US into a war with Iran is following a depressingly familiar playbook to those who lived through—and those who served in—the US wars in Iraq and Afghanistan. In this episode of The Marc Steiner Show, Marc speaks with military veteran, author, and peace activist Rory Fanning—who served two tours in combat as an Army Ranger in Afghanistan—about the reality of what the US military has done in the Middle East, and about the veterans who are speaking out against the US-Israeli war with Iran.

Guests:

Rory Fanning is a war resister, military counter recruiter, and writer living in Chicago, IL. Fanning served two deployments with the Second Army Ranger Battalion in Afghanistan, and he is the author of Worth Fighting For: An Army Ranger’s Journey Out of the Military and Across America.
